I would like to ask the experts out there: in the ion membrane electrolysis process, is there any way to treat the brine and sludge resulting from the primary salt solution without using plate and frame filtration?
In the ion-exchange membrane electrolysis process for treating saline wastewater, the salt sludge generated (also known as saturated salt sludge) represents a processing challenge. Normally, salt sludge is dewatered using plate and frame filtration or other solid-liquid separation techniques. If you are looking for alternatives to plate and frame filter presses, here are some possible techniques: 1. Centrifugal dewatering: Using a centrifuge to remove water from sludge, with high-speed rotation generating strong centrifugal force to separate solids from liquids. 2. Vacuum filtration: Utilizes vacuum force to draw out the moisture from the salt sludge, and achieves solid-liquid separation through media such as filter cloth. 3. Screw dehydrator: It dehydrates the salt sludge by using a rotating screw shaft to push it forward and squeeze out the water. 4. Concentration and sedimentation: Allow the salt sludge to settle and concentrate naturally in a sedimentation tank, and separate out the more concentrated salt sludge by removing the supernatant liquid. 5. Flotation: In some special cases, flotation technology can be used to separate solid particles from a liquid. 6. Drying treatment: The salt mud is dried using heating or other drying methods. Although this approach involves higher operational costs, it may be feasible in certain special situations. 7. Chemical treatment: Flocculants or other chemical agents are added to facilitate solid-liquid separation, and the dehydrated salt sludge is then disposed of using one of the aforementioned dewatering devices. Each technology has its own advantages and limitations; choosing the appropriate method requires consideration of the actual processing requirements, equipment investment and operating costs, as well as the desired quality of the output. Due to the significant differences in environmental and economic benefits among various processes, experiments and pilot tests are sometimes required to determine the optimal treatment method. In practical operations, multiple methods are sometimes used together to improve dehydration efficiency and reduce processing costs. .
